Luka Doncic Becomes Footwear Free Agent After Nike Deal Expires

The former Nike athlete and reigning NBA ROY has global appeal and is known to wear colorful sneakersNBAE/GETTY IMAGES

The two-year contract Mavericks G Luka Doncic "signed with Nike during his final season at Real Madrid expired" yesterday, as did Nike's 180-day window to "match the highest bidder and keep Doncic," according to Brad Townsend of the DALLAS MORNING NEWS. Doncic said, "Yeah, I'm a free agent now. So we'll see what we do." It now "seems a given" that the reigning NBA Rookie of the Year's shoe/apparel annual average will "easily surpass" the $7.68M he will make in salary from the Mavs in '19-20. Doncic, who is from Slovenia, has "world appeal," and he is "known for wearing colorful sneakers." Doncic said, "It's very important, this deal. First of all, if the shoe is good for my feet, to have a long career. But, yeah, the look, too" (DALLAS MORNING NEWS, 10/1).
